You will, among other things, work with:

  • Conduct and assist in risk assessments of the work environment

  • Plan and conduct measurements of chemical, physical and biological factors to assess exposure levels

  • Map and analyze the work environment to identify potential health hazards associated with chemical use and other exposures

  • Develop procedures and guidelines based on findings from risk assessments and measurements

  • Suggest and implement measures that reduce or eliminate exposure to hazardous substances and conditions

  • Contribute to training and increased awareness of health, safety and occupational hygiene safety and good occupational hygiene

  • Provide guidance and training in the proper use of personal protective equipment

  • Participate in inspections and evaluations of the working environment

  • Keep up to date on current regulations and best practices in HSE and occupational hygiene
